I am using imagesc to plot a map. There are 8 possible variables that can be included in a pixel, hence the plot is of values 1-8. Most pixels only have one number included, however some have 2. To accurately represent this I wonder if it is possible to somehow split a pixel in half so that when I plot the map using imagesc it shows 2 colours (e.g. the colour representing 1 and the colour representing 5)
Is there a simple solution to achieve this?

No. You will need to create a new matrix twice as wide (or twice as tall) in which each pair of locations is either set the same (one color) or is set differently (two colors)
